B615 THE PROFESSIONAL CERTIFICATE IN MANAGEMENT

With its foundation management models and techniques (NVQ Level 4), this course will help you to increase your knowledge, competence and confidence as a new, general or middle manager. You’ll look at your role and how to develop it within an organisational context, learning to recognise your strengths and overcome your weaknesses. You’ll learn how to work more effectively with colleagues and staff, covering issues of recruitment, motivation, teamwork and leadership, and how to interpret and use financial and other information. Finally, you’ll explore marketing and quality management concepts to help you to add value for your customers – understanding and satisfying their needs and communicating with them. DD304 UNDERSTANDING CITIES AUDIO CDS

These highly topical learning resources are structured around an exploration of the problems and potential of cities. The resources also investigate the ways in which cities are connected to each other and the effects that these connections have in particular cities.
